前提:最近写了个java代码,打成 jar 包放到服务器上 java -jar 启动后报错 Error: Could not find or load main class 建议,使用 idea 中的 terminal 进行调试 terminal.png 报错原因 查询过关于这个错误的报错原因,网上有很多,但无非是打包错误,环境问题。最后通过 terminal 调试发现报错原因 netty.png 查看本地...
1.1 报错信息 # java -jar shiro_4.5.6-SNAPSHOT-all.jar Picked up _JAVA_OPTIONS: -Dawt.useSystemAAFontSettings=on -Dswing.aatext=true Error: Could not find or load main class com.summersec.attack.UI.Main Caused by: java.lang.NoClassDefFoundError: javafx/application/Application 1.2 报错截图 ...
springboot + maven 打包成jar包后,使用java jar命令启动jar包时,报错:Could not find or load main class org.springframework.boot.loader.JarLauncher 问题解决 需要在pom文件中使用相应的springboot maven 打包插件,并且指定相应的启动类,即mainClass。如下: <build> <plugins> <plugin> <groupId>org.springfr...
Could not find or load main class org.apache.hive.jdbc.HiveDriver 1. 这个错误提示是由于缺少HiveDriver的jar包导致的。DBeaver需要HiveDriver的jar包才能正确连接Hive数据库。 2. 解决方法 要解决这个问题,我们需要手动添加HiveDriver的jar包到DBeaver的classpath中。下面是具体的解决步骤: 打开DBeaver,进入"数...
jar 执行java 里main Could not find or load main class 执行jar包中指定main方法, java运行jar包中指定Class的main方法 用OneJar打包后java-jar***.jar总是运行指定的主方法,现在工程中有很多其他的主方法,想要运行指定的。可以用下面的命令:java-classpat
首先用winrar打开jar包,里面有个mate-inf文件夹,把里面的manifest.mf文件拷出来,打开,如下:Manifest-Version: 1.0 Created-By: 1.6.0_06 (Sun Microsystems Inc.)Main-Class: thinkerbell.src.MainClassAction(你需要把这里改成你的启动class文件路径,就是main方法在哪个class中,就写哪个class...
windows 双击执行jar包出现:could not find the main class 2013-06-25 16:30 − {一}动机 最近自己写了个小应用,用于生成子系统树需要的配置信息,打包为可执行jar发给其他同事使用时双击jar包提示“could not find the main class”. 首先当然要检查一下JRE环境等,经过一番折腾整理如下几项注意点(首先说明...
呵呵 这个简单 在你的jar文件的inf文件里指定manifest为你的mian()方法的类名就好了
报错 [root@xc-v-ct-wg-wbgl-app-14 wenTest]# java -jar pushData.jar Error: Could not find or load main class com.pengyue.job.Today image.png 解决办法 ,一定不要放在这个 /main/java 目录下。 特别是spark程序 报错 Exception in thread "main" java.lang.SecurityException: Invalid signature fi...
你把原先生成的jar包删了 从新在netbeans中:右击你要打包的工程——>属性——>运行,把其中的主类设置成你自己写的含有main()函数的那个类,可通过“浏览”找到。之后再右击工程选择“生成”就好了 这时候生成的jar包应该可以用javaw.exe打开了 ...